BELGRADE - Serbian Interior Minister Ivica Dacic said on Tuesday Western powers were pressuring countries that might support a draft UN General Assembly resolution on Srebrenica and noted that, even though the outcome of a vote on the document would not be favourable for Serbia, Western states would not be satisfied either because they expected a two-third majority.
Speaking to Pink TV, Dacic said the situation was quite difficult.
"I have spoken personally with 73 FMs... I have also spoken with the late Iranian minister. However, the situation is changing on a daily basis. They have a new FM now and he is in additional consultations now," Dacic said.
He said many countries would abstain in the UNGA vote but that, according to the rules, only votes for and against counted.
